Quasi-probability Wigner densities and characterization of Gaussian distribution
Zapiski Nauchnykh Seminarov POMI, Probability and statistics. Part 1, Tome 228 (1996), pp. 142-153
Voir la notice de l'article provenant de la source Math-Net.Ru
A new characterization of the Gaussian distribution by nonnegativity of a quazi-probability Wigner density was established by R. Hudson in 1974. Some sharpenings and extensions of this result are proposed, and connections with some other characterizations of Gaussian distribution are established. Linnik's “ridge principle” is essentially used. Bibl. 11 titles.
